Output e81adb598deaea31ec7029b502496d4a14a41472aa2fc9d5b4de02ceb0394138:6

value
744716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34a8f495966bf33b30fe7ce93eb98c3aeb6b0eaf OP_EQUAL
address
36VTTkFKbEfHwU8Pmvnvx3a26ALiSnKcBS
transaction
e81adb598deaea31ec7029b502496d4a14a41472aa2fc9d5b4de02ceb0394138
spent
true